Locking Out Changes, and Unlocking Again
Once the unit is set up, it may be locked against casual interference by holding
down the
down the
Status
button and pressing the
Store
button.
appears on the right hand side of the
Status
,
Error Monitor
,
Test
Mode
,
Info
,
Bit Activity Monitor
or
Level Meter
screen as appropriate and the
front panel controls have no effect.
To restore normal operation, hold down the
Status
button and press the
Edit
button. The
label will disappear and normal operation will be
resumed.
